Economist: FNM Banking Reform Plan A Step In The Right Direction
NASSAU, BAHAMAS – While a banking reform plan proposed by Free National Movement Leader Michael Pintard is being called a step in the right direction from economist Edison Sumner, he says still much more needs to be done.
